What you'll be doing; Manage 10 employees and the daily operations of the Rochester Transfer Station, ensuring the site operates safely and efficiently. Control the movement of materials in and out of the transfer station. Ensure the site has competent operational staff who feel empowered and motivated. Ensure material is dispatched as per waste flow requirements. Build relationships with customers and colleagues, including the wider Veolia Municipal team. Build a partnership with local council members. Ensure staff are fully trained and identify areas of training needed. Maximise and utilise the fixed and mobile plant on site. Ensure any defects or damages are reported. Act as a deputy for the Contract Manager during annual leave or other absences. Assist the contact Manager with the annual budget and forecasting.
What we're looking for; Experience of people management. Health and Safety Knowledge and experience. Environmental Knowledge and experience. COTC (Certificate of Technical Competence) Transfer Hazardous. Experience within the waste management industry is desirable. IOSH is desirable.
